General Spruance

MCGHEE TYSON AIR NATIONAL GUARD BASE, Tenn. – U.S. Air National Guard Brig. Gen. William W. Spruance lectures students here at the I.G. Brown Training and Education Center. Spruance was a strong supporter of the Center, of which its multi-media building, Spruance Hall, was dedicated in his name. After surviving a fiery crash as a passenger in a T-33 in 1961, he made thousands of presentations on flying safety and crash survival and continued his lifelong support of aviation education and Air National Guard service. Spruance died Jan. 15, 2011. (U.S. Air National Guard file-photo/Released)
